International Agreement on Climate Treaty Seems Unlikely in 2009

International Agreement on Climate Treaty Seems Unlikely in 2009 REUTERS Jun 14, 2009

By Mridul Chadha

It seems unlikely that an agreement on the terms of the next climate treaty could be reached at the December-scheduled Copenhagen talks………………..Many lawmakers are pushing for nuclear power to be included in the climate bill ……………However, they are at conflict of ideas with the environmentalists who argue that the nuclear waste that would be generated from these nuclear plants will pose serious management issues given the fact that President Obama wants to close the Yucca Mountain storage facility. Furthermore, the increase in number of nuclear power plants would also poses national security issues.
